O R D E R

This writ petition has been filed seeking issuance of a writ of Certiorarified Mandamus to quash the impugned order passed by the 1st respondent vide letter No.Pen13/II/ppt No.12029/45865 dated 24.07.2015 and consequently, direct the 1st respondent to sanction/disburse the family pension to the petitioner from 02.05.2012 to 29.05.2016, till the completion of 25 years, with interest.

2. The case of the petitioner as stated in the affidavit filed in support of the writ petition is that his father is one A.Ramadoss who pre-deceased his mother, Sivaprakasam. They were blessed with three children apart from the petitioner. The petitioner's mother was working as Head Mistress at Mattiyur Elementary School(aided), Thirupananthal Union, Tanjore District and she 2/7

attained superannuation on 30.04.2004 and she died on 02.05.2012. The petitioner was aged 21 years at the time of demise of his mother. The elder siblings of the petitioner had crossed the age of 25 years by then and the petitioner was the only person entitled to receive family pension. The 3rd respondent vide letter No.R.C.No. C1614/2014 dated 19.11.2014 recommended the petitioner for family pension as per G.O.Ms.No.235 Fin(PC) dated 01.06.2009, to the 1st respondent. The 1st respondent directed the petitioner to produce income certificate from the Tahsildar concerned. The 2nd respondent issued a computerized and standard certificate stating that the petitioner has an income of Rs.36,000/- annually.

It is the specific case of the petitioner that the said income certificate is not correct as the petitioner does not have any income at all and he has no employment. It is also stated that the petitioner is living in poverty and he does not have any movable or immovable assets in his name. The petitioner has given a representation on 31.12.2015 to the 2nd respondent requesting him to issue a fresh income certificate. However, in and by the impugned order, the petitioner's request for family pension has been rejected which is under challenge in the present writ petition.

The 1st respondent has filed a counter affidavit stating that the income certificate issued by the Tahsildar clearly mentioned the annual income of the petitioner is Rs.36,000/- which is excess of the income limit of Rs.2,550/- per month prescribed by Government, for becoming eligible for family pension.

4.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ned counsel for the 1st respondent and the learned Government Advocate for the 2nd and 3rd respondents.

5. This Court also perused the records available in the typed set of papers. It is seen that the income certificate dated 29.12.2014 issued by the 2nd respondent is an online income certificate and the income certificate appears to be issued in a prescribed format. Be that as it may, the petitioner has approached the 2nd respondent/Tahsildar on 31.12.2015 stating that the income certificate issued by the Tahsildar is incorrect and that he does not have any kind of income whatsoever and hence, he requested the 2nd respondent/Tahsildar to issue a fresh income certificate. 4/7

6. It is the specific case of the petitioner that being the only sibling, who was entitled to family pension and being below the age of 25 years and qualifying for the family pension, he made an application. The specific case of the petitioner is that he does not have any income and he was certainly entitled to family pension. The respondents have solely relied on the income certificate of the Tahsildar to deprive his rights seeking family pension. Therefore, this Court feels that when the petitioner had objected to the income certificate issued by the Tahsildar within a reasonable time, it would be appropriate to direct the 1st respondent to consider the petitioner's case afresh after giving opportunity to the petitioner to establish the factum for eligible of family pension as on the relevant date and in terms of the then prevailing pension scheme.

7. Accordingly, the impugned order passed by the 1st respondent vide letter No.Pen13/II/ppt No.12029/45865 dated 24.07.2015 is set aside and 1st respondent shall consider the petitioner's case afresh and pass orders on merits and in accordance with law, within a period of six we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
